Hardwood vs engineered wood flooring knowing the difference between hardwood and engineered wood flooring will give you the advantage of choosing the best flooring option for you.
Solid hardwood flooring boards tend to be narrower than engineered hardwood flooring.
Engineered flooring is typically between 3 8 to 3 4 thick whereas solid hardwood is 1 2 to 3 4 thick.
Both are made of wood.
Hardwood flooring consists of sawed planks from natural hardwood timbers like oak and maple and is sometimes called solid wood hardwood flooring is more expensive than engineered hardwood a k a engineered wood flooring which is constructed from thin glued together layers of derivative wood products such as osb mdf or plywood.
Solid hardwood is available in both pre finished and unfinished boards.
Each is made from 100 real wood.
